8226 45th Ave, Flushing, NY 11373-3539

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 11373:
4105 74th St, Flushing, NY 11373-1821
9430 60th Ave, Flushing, NY 11373-5081
5282 79th St, Flushing, NY 11373-4101
5008 92nd St, Flushing, NY 11373-4051
4225 78th St, Flushing, NY 11373-2953